NEW DELHI: Keeping up his party’s attack on BJP over repeated NEET fiascos, Congress MP Rahul Gandhi on Saturday said education minister Dharmendra Pradhan should be sacked for the paper leaks that “destroyed the hard work and future of crores of students” under Modi govt.Congress president Mallikarjun Kharge said PM Narendra Modi should hold “paper leak pe charcha”, in a reference to the annual “pariksha pe charcha”.Rahul slammed Pradhan for his reported remarks that he did not pay attention to the recommendation of the parliamentary committee on education about NTA. Jairam Ramesh said Pradhan’s remark showed he was not cut out for the minister’s job.Kharge said “Amrit Kaal” was proving to be “Mrit Kaal” for students.
